Output c321309ce8dfef896b3f45773c4702e551e0e7ed6fa5588941609c528399792e:42

value
1044774
script pubkey
OP_0 OP_PUSHBYTES_32 530970e60a3a2093823843789c2a4e99046fbb31fba6092ec69953e3e2fd8e37
address
bc1q2vyhpes28gsf8q3cgdufc2jwnyzxlwe3lwnqjtkxn9f78cha3cmsrwhh8k
transaction
c321309ce8dfef896b3f45773c4702e551e0e7ed6fa5588941609c528399792e
spent
true